<p>The first and most important thing to get is your tent. Look for one that best suits your needs while at the same time make sure it is suitable for the weather conditions of the place you are planning to visit. A comfortable sleeping bag is next on the list. These come in all different shapes, sizes, colours, fabric and materials. If you are looking for better insulation, then include a sleeping mat or an inflated mat, this will give you added comfort.</p>
<p>Your list of foodstuff that you intend to carry depends on how many people are going to eat that food. It would be advisable to avoid taking perishable food because of the difficulty of storing it. As for the cooking and eating utensils you could carry a frying pan, two or three pots, a cooking spoon, spatula while plastic plates, spoons and cups would do beautifully for your meals. You should carry spare containers with you just in case you have any left over food; this can be stored and used for your next meal.</p>
<p>A camp stove can be very handy, if bad weather forbids you to light up a campfire. A camp stove is also a must. You will be amazed of how much you can do with it. You can cook some good fresh meals if you are prepared to take the trouble.</p>
<p>Matches, llighters and flashlights are also useful items to include in the packing as fending for yourself in the dark can be difficult without them. When you are camping you should also take a first-aid kit, this can be very handy at times. Please see below some of the items included in the kit; insect repellent, aspirin, strips of band-aid, cotton balls, antiseptic ointment, gauze, sunscreen, an antibiotic, aspirin, a burn spray.</p>
<p>It is difficult choosing clothes for your trip, as you need to select clothes that are going to be suitable for the weather you may face, yet they need to be lightweight. Clothes that retain the damp or do not dry fast are not a very good idea, so don&#8217;t take them. Rain gear that is lightweight can be included if you want as this is useful in a shower. Sneakers are the perfect footwear to include unless you are planning on doing loads of hiking. If this is the case include a pair of sturdy boots.</p>
<p>Apart from these you will need a pair of sunglasses to protect your eyes from the harsh sun. You can also do with other necessities such as a small hatchet, an all-purpose knife, a deck of cards, a book or two and any other thing that you would prefer as a pastime.</p>
<p>One thing you must remember is that whatever you take with you, must be lightweight specifically if you are going backpacking because you would not want to come back with a bad back. You will be ready for your camping trip once you have gathered all the essential stuff and checked out it&#8217;s weight. Carry it about for a few minutes to see how you feel.</p>
